Overview
The 74LS00SC is a quad 2-input NAND gate integrated circuit (IC) produced by National Semiconductor. It belongs to the 74LS series of logic devices, which are widely used in digital electronics for their low power consumption and high-speed performance. This IC is designed for applications requiring basic logic operations, making it a fundamental component in digital circuit design. Key Specifications
Parameter | Value | Unit | Notes |
---|---|---|---|
Logic Type | NAND Gate | - | Quad 2-input |
Supply Voltage | 4.75 to 5.25 | V | Typical 5V |
Operating Temperature | 0 to 70 | °C | - |
Propagation Delay | 9 | ns | Max at 5V |
Power Dissipation | 2 | mW | Per gate |
Package | SOIC | - | Surface Mount |
